NGC 3373 – Details of a Part of the Eta Carinae Nebula

OTA: PW17 f/6.5
Camera: FLI ML16803 CCD
Observatory: Deep Sky West, Chile

Exposures:
H: 11 x 1800 sec
O: 10 x 1800
S: 11 x 1800
Total Exposure time used: 16 hours
Image Width: 43.3 arc-minutes

Processing Tools:
1.    Commercial: PixInsight, Topaz Studio, Topaz Denoise, Topaz Gigapixel, Aurora HDR, Luminar Neo, 3DLUT Creator
2.    Pixinsight Addons: NoiseXTerminator, BlurXTerminator, StarXTerminator, Normalize Scale Gradient
3.    My Scripts: NB_Assistant, AC_Restar, Subframe Weighting Tool

Target Description:
This image portrays a portion of the Eta Carinae Nebula just south of that triple junction of dark lanes. One pixel in this image spans 5x10^11 km of nebula!

Processing Description:
The original HSO images were mapped to true color and calibrated photometrically, and the stars were removed. From that point forward, I adjusted the colors with differential stretches and color remapping to achieve the tons and hues I wanted for this image. Keeping the saturation low reveals more detail, although, admittedly, high saturation generally floats my boat!
